indexed-traversable 0.1.3 → 0.1.4
raw patch · 4 files changed
+20/−112 lines, 4 filesdep −base-orphansdep −generic-derivingdep −ghc-primdep ~basedep ~containersdep ~transformers
Dependencies removed: base-orphans, generic-deriving, ghc-prim, semigroups, tagged, transformers-compat, void
Dependency ranges changed: base, containers, transformers
